Seniors in assisted living would appreciate Salisbury, North Carolina for its vibrant community and accessible amenities tailored to their needs. The city boasts the Livingstone College Community Garden, which provides residents with opportunities for social engagement and horticultural activities. The Rowan County Senior Center hosts a variety of programs and services, including exercise classes, nutrition workshops, and art therapy sessions that promote well-being among older adults. Furthermore, Salisbury's proximity to medical facilities like Novant Health allows for easy access to healthcare services. These features contribute to a fulfilling lifestyle in Salisbury, making it an enticing option for seniors seeking supportive environments.

Considerations for seniors living in Salisbury, NC
Affordable cost of living: The cost of living in Salisbury is lower than the national average, making it more affordable for seniors on a fixed income.
Accessible healthcare: Salisbury has several healthcare facilities including hospitals and clinics which makes healthcare easily accessible.
Mild climate: Salisbury's climate is temperate with mild winters which are beneficial for seniors who may have health conditions that worsen with cold weather.
Cultural activities: Salisbury has a rich history and culture with museums, theaters, and art galleries, providing opportunities for entertainment and education for seniors.
Active retirement communities: Several active retirement communities in Salisbury offer amenities such as fitness centers and social activities for seniors to remain active and engage with their peers.
Natural surroundings: The city is surrounded by beautiful natural landscapes including parks and lakes which provide a peaceful environment for seniors to enjoy outdoor activities.
Transportation options: Public transportation is available within the city limits as well as access to regional airports nearby which makes travel convenient for visiting friends and family or for medical purposes.
Community support: Salisbury has a strong community spirit where local organizations offer resources to help seniors age gracefully such as volunteer programs, senior centers, etc.
